Delhi HC Directs GB Pant Hospital To Admit Critically Ill Patient

New Delhi: Delhi High Court directed GB Pant Hospital to immediately admit a young critical heart patient and provide treatment to her free of cost.

Jasmeen, 13, was denied treatment at GB Pant Hospital despite a written request by LNJP (Lok Nayak Jai Prakash) Hospital.

Jasmeen’s father on Monday moved the Delhi High Court. After hearing the matter, Delhi HC directed the hospital to immediately admit the girl and provide her treatment free of cost.
